Going Into Soil Recycling: Turning "Used" Dirt into Garden Gold


Dirt recycling begins by recognizing what you're dealing with. If the soil has actually been previously made use of in planting beds or construction, it may be compacted or depleted of nutrients. But this does not imply it's pointless-- it just needs recovery.


Start by evaluating your soil. Getting rid of debris like rocks, origins, and trash provides you a tidy base. If it's clay-heavy or excessively sandy, blending it with compost or raw material improves structure and nutrient web content. Recycled soil is best for elevated beds, flower beds, and even new lawn installations. By choosing to work with what you already have, you're cutting transportation discharges and lowering the demand for fresh mined earth. It's a subtle change, yet when multiplied across areas, its ecological impact is enormous.


Reclaiming the Beauty in Hardscape: Giving Old Materials New Purpose


Following time you knock down a patio area or dig up a garden border, do not be so quick to throw those damaged pavers or broke bricks. Hardscape products like rock, concrete, and brick are unbelievably long lasting-- and highly multiple-use. They can become rustic bordering, lovely tipping stones, or the foundation of a brand-new path.


And afterwards there this site are decorative rocks. These components don't wear-- they just get transferred. Recovering river rocks, pea gravel, or smashed granite from old setups and redistributing them artistically saves cash and protects against the demand for more quarrying. Compost, Wood, and Green Waste: Composting and Reusing with Intention


Timber chips, leaves, and yard cuttings are usually scooped and hauled off, only to wind up in community waste. However these products are the best structure for compost or compost. Instead of acquire new every period, numerous gardeners currently develop their very own mulch from shredded branches or autumn leaves.


Self-made mulch not just subdues weeds and retains dirt dampness however likewise slowly breaks down to nourish the dirt. Gradually, this builds a healthy expanding atmosphere that's far more sustainable than artificial fertilizers or imported changes.


If you're expanding into composting, environment-friendly waste like veggie scraps, lawn cuttings, and coffee grounds can feed your dirt.
